Barbara Hoon is the owner and founder of Six Degrees Pilates. Barbara brings a wealth of experience from her professional dance background, beginning as an original member of the notorious Twyla Tharp Dance Company upon her graduation from The Juilliard School in New York City. During her six years with Twyla Tharp, Barbara created distinguished roles in celebrated pieces including The Catherine Wheel and The Sinatra Suites, in which she danced alongside Mikhail Baryshnikov. Barbara continued her career on the Broadway stage, where she performed featured roles in Singin’ in the Rain, West Side Story, Jerome Robbins’ Broadway, Carousel, and South Pacific. Barbara performed in the Academy Award winning film Amadeus as well as feature films Zelig and Bugsy. She also appeared on television in national commercials, soap operas, and the popular show Picket Fences. Barbara discovered Pilates while training at The Juilliard School, where she learned the technique from pupils of Pilates master teachers. She most notably honed her craft with her teacher and trainer of twenty years, Patrick Strong, a New York City disciple of the world renowned Romana Kryzanowska. After teaching Pilates in New York City, Los Angeles, Toronto, and New Jersey, Barbara’s diverse experience and wide fan-base prompted her to open her own studio.
